Originally Posted by 6chr0nic4
for those of you that got stick... what are your driving habits like

what do u usually shift at?

i shift at around 2.5 - 3 range and my buddy keeps bugging me about it not being good for the engine... saying since its a sports car i should be ripping it at higher revs... ive heard this elsewhere as well is it true?

i usually shift around that range for better gas milege... also.. im sitting at around 12,000 clicks.. so my clutch still grabs relatively hard, unless i ride the clutch slightly when i shift.. the car rocks a bit.. do i just suck at shifting or is this normal? THANKS!!
Your buddy is an idiot... This VQ makes tones of Torque down low so there is no need to turn it up unless you just want to... I usually shift anywhere between 2-3500K depending on traffic flow or how I feel if I'm just riding or commuting... Your buddy must own a VTEC
With that said, it will hurt nothing to turn it up if you want to, but your just burning fuel and causing more wear over the life of the engine for no good reason. I do run the sh*t out of mine, even to redline a few times a week just because I like it, but most of the time I just keep it down low...
